Abstract

The Indonesia Pintar Program (PIP) is an enhanced support program for the government for Poor Student Assistance (BSM). The PIP program is expected to help students who are economically disadvantaged and can ease the burden of disadvantaged families, and withdraw students who drop out of school due to delinquent fees. So it is hoped that there will be no more reason not to continue their education to a higher level because of cost problems. For the use of funds to be used as effectively and efficiently as possible. Thus the PIP program can support the government's 12-year compulsory education program. Both programs can go hand in hand with the Indonesian national goal of Educating the Nation's Life.
